Uganda Cancer Institute Gets New Bosses.

By Adiga Julius

The Uganda Cancer Institute, has unveiled new board members of the institute following the expiration of the tenure of the old board.

Inaugurating the new board at Serena hotel Victoria, the Minister of Health  Dr. Jane Ruth Acheng urged the new board to put more emphasis on the prevention and early detection of cancer in Uganda.

Minister of Health Dr. Jane Ruth Acheng

“The new board needs to put new strategies to reach out to the people and preach prevention, “Dr. Acheng said.

She added that the majority of cancer patients are women suffering from the cancer of the cervix and breast cancers.

The outgoing chairman of the board, Oncologist Professor. Dr. and the pioneer (UCI ) Executive Director Dr.Charles Olweny said some success achieved include construction of the new cancer ward and construction of radiotherapy bunkers.

Outgoing Board Chairman Prof Charles Olweny ,Welcoming the New board chairman Dr. William Bazeyo

These according to Dr. Olweny were constructed  before Parliament passed the UCI Bill which granted it full autonomy as a body cooperation institution.

 

The newly appointed chairman of (UCI) Prof. William Bazeyo Promised to ensure that Uganda Cancer Institute becomes a Center where patients go for treatment  as opposed to seeking specialized treatment from Bankoko and India among others.

The 11 member board was sworn in by the deputy registrar of anti-corruption court Pamela Lamono.

Prof. William Bazeyo Taking an Oath as the New Chairman of UCI Board

The 11 members include Prof. William Bazeyo as chairman , acting executive director of Mulago specialized hospital Dr. Rosemary Byanyima as Secretary to the board , other members include Dr. Charles Olaro ,Gertrude Nakigudde, Fatia Kiyange, Sarah Nafuna ,Counsel Mayambala Kasolo, Joseph Kasaija, Prilla Kabagambe Prof. Isaac Kajja  and Dr. Jackson Orem Uganda Cancer Institute Executive. Director.

This was the second board of the institute since the Uganda cancer institute act was enacted in 2016.
